The map sensor is a 3 bar sensor. 1 bar = 14.7psi. Sea level = 1 Bar so Zero boost on the gauge is about 1 bar on the sensor. That leaves 2 bar for boost = 2x14.7 = 29.4. Allowing for a fudge factor the most you will see reliably is 29-30 PSI.
